Snow Time has announced that season passes and advantage cards will go on sale at preseason rates on August 1st for their three Mid-Atlantic ski areas, Liberty, Roundtop, and Whitetail.   Pre-season rates are good through 10/31, with a resort cash bonus of $50 or $25 dollars depending on which season pass is purchased added to the season pass card if purchased before 9/30.  Resort cash can be used to make any purchases at the three ski areas.  Rates for season passes and advantage cards are the same as last year and a pass or advantage card purchased at one resort can be used at the other two resorts.

A season pass purchased before the rates go up will pay for itself after 7 - 10 trips to any of the ski areas depending on when you visit, i.e. weekend, mid-week, or night time.  If you are likely to visit a combination of these ski areas 10 times or more in the 2012/2013 season, it would be worth it to pick up a season pass.  

 

If you are not sure if you will be skiing at a Snow Time ski area that often, but are sure you will at least make it to one 4 or 5 times during the season, then the Advantage card is a good deal.  The Advantage card gives you 40% off the ticket price when you purchase a ticket and every 6th ticket is free.  My advantage card paid for itself after 4 visits last year and was well worth it.
